We spent four nights here and really enjoyed it - great A/C, free internet, so close to a Metro stop. There is not a ton of stuff open right around the hotel at night, so we generally took the Metro. We went to a jazz club on a Sunday night and were surprised to find the Metro had stopped running.... more

The Villa Emilia may just be the best bargain in Barcelona. The rooms are very tastefully appointed with a color scheme that is both relaxing and unique. It is a modern hotel, so it uses key cards to open the doors and turn on the lights. The bathroom fixtures are very nice, with on-demand hot water. The room I was... more
